diff options
author | Cédric Bonhomme <kimble.mandel@gmail.com> | 2013-03-28 09:56:11 +0100 |
---|---|---|
committer | Cédric Bonhomme <kimble.mandel@gmail.com> | 2013-03-28 09:56:11 +0100 |
commit | 6776bd3e56cd5b3b8d26102bf6e5f2337bba7529 (patch) | |
tree | 7dc14d640c2414b88f2dab7a0c3fd8f3e4fdf276 /source | |
parent | Minor fix to the /feed view when a feed has no articles. (diff) | |
download | newspipe-6776bd3e56cd5b3b8d26102bf6e5f2337bba7529.tar.gz newspipe-6776bd3e56cd5b3b8d26102bf6e5f2337bba7529.tar.bz2 newspipe-6776bd3e56cd5b3b8d26102bf6e5f2337bba7529.zip |
Minor fix to the /inactives view when a feed has no articles.
Diffstat (limited to 'source')
-rwxr-xr-x | source/pyAggr3g470r.py | 9 |
1 files changed, 5 insertions, 4 deletions
diff --git a/source/pyAggr3g470r.py b/source/pyAggr3g470r.py index 5a55cacf..8b222f68 100755 --- a/source/pyAggr3g470r.py +++ b/source/pyAggr3g470r.py @@ -443,10 +443,11 @@ class pyAggr3g470r(object): inactives = [] for feed in feeds: more_recent_article = self.mongo.get_articles(feed["feed_id"], limit=1) - last_post = next(more_recent_article)["article_date"] - elapsed = today - last_post - if elapsed > datetime.timedelta(days=int(nb_days)): - inactives.append((feed, elapsed)) + if more_recent_article.count() != 0: + last_post = next(more_recent_article)["article_date"] + elapsed = today - last_post + if elapsed > datetime.timedelta(days=int(nb_days)): + inactives.append((feed, elapsed)) tmpl = lookup.get_template("inactives.html") return tmpl.render(inactives=inactives, nb_days=int(nb_days)) |